Team Colors is a reference of HEX, RGB, CMYK, and Pantone color values of major league sports teams.
Gulp is used to compile all necessary static assets locally into assets/
. Those are then pushed to github pages which deploys and hosts the assets (hence the CNAME
file).
To run, simply do npm install
to get all necessary packages. Then run gulp
to compile everything (or for developing).
Static index.html
file is loaded with all necessary data. If javascript is supported, it loads styles and vector versions of the team logos (if SVG is supported by the browser).
Color data is rendered from each correspondingly-named league .json
file in src/data/
. Any changes to the data of the page can be done from those files.
Note on colors: Color definitions for each team are in arrays and grouped by color mode. Color values should match index position in the array across color modes, for example:
colors:
rgb: TEAMS-RGB-BLUE, TEAMS-RGB-RED
hex: TEAMS-HEX-BLUE, TEAMS-HEX-RED

All NBA colors are official (source user & pass: nbamedia).
The NBA only provides RGB, CMYK, and Pantone colors for each team, so the HEX color is a programmatic conversion of the RGB color.
All NFL colors are official (see sources below).
The NFL provides official RGB, HEX, CMYK, and Pantone colors (so none of the colors you see on Team Colors are conversions).
The NFL has logo slicks which detail team color values. These are provided on a per-conference basis. Note: each of these source links are over 100MB in size, so they take a while to download.
These leagues’ teams and colors are currently approximations. I am working on getting official colors. If you know how/where to find them, please open an issue here in Github.
